The Exploding Toilet

A humorous collection of modern urban myths and legends grouped under chapters as "School Days," "The Home Front," "Scary Stories," "Scams and Conspiracies," and "Dumb Luck and Bad Breaks."

The other, more negative, reviewer is a little harsh but I can see his point. This isn't a book that you become enamored with necessarily the minute you pick it up. It seems to be a bit more basic, less comprehensive or "professional" than something you might want for the genre. STILL...if you read through it's first half and haven't found yourself engaged or smiling regularly - then I think there might be something wrong with you.Major folk tale, legends, or "weird short stories" fans may really be able to get something out of it. That's why I bought it - because I like the much shorter, more unpredictable stories out there of all kinds. They're all just so fun and easy to read. Whether it's Brothers Grimm or old American scary stories - these kinds of legends and fairy tales (well-known or not) - always seem to rise above with a certain charm.That being said, I'll admit to only liking about half of the "tales" included within this title. Some seem pointless. However, some of the ones I did like are real gems that I'd be happy to re-read down the line. I would try this book because, at the end of the day, the authors have done a neat job of laying out these pieces while including some good ones that you might not be able to find in-print anywhere else.
